Now that all Hungarian medical universities are public and follow the very similar regulations enforced by their government, the tuition fees also range highly similar to one another.
- General Medicine: $9,000 USD per semester
- Dentistry: $9,500 USD per semester
- Pharmacy: $5,000 USD per semester
Unfortunately, the Hungarian universities do not offer that various scholarship opportunities or student loan options. Rather, the best 1-3 students each semester gets rewarded either full scholarship or 30-50% discount on their next tuition fee.
(*The average living cost in Hungary can range between $600 and $1,500 USD, depending on the type of rent and cities.)
